Motor Power and Speed
The Tideway Hair Dryer boasts a high-speed 110,000 RPM motor, providing powerful drying capabilities with a 1500W output. In contrast, the Wavytalk Hair Dryer features a robust 1875W motor that promises to dry hair twice as fast while minimizing heat damage. The higher wattage of the Wavytalk may translate into quicker drying times, which is essential for busy individuals. Despite the Tideway's impressive RPM, the Wavytalk's motor efficiency could offer a more practical solution for those who prioritize speed in their hair drying routine.

Features and Technology
The Tideway Hair Dryer features innovative plasma hair care technology that releases 200 million active plasma ions to reduce frizz and enhance moisture retention. This is particularly beneficial for those with curly or color-treated hair. Conversely, the Wavytalk Hair Dryer focuses on ionic frizz reduction and includes three attachments: a concentrated nozzle, a diffuser, and a comb for versatile styling. While both dryers aim to tackle frizz and enhance hair quality, the Tideway's unique plasma technology may offer a distinct advantage for users seeking to improve scalp health and moisture retention.
Temperature Control and Customization
The Tideway Hair Dryer comes equipped with NTC Smart Temperature Control, ensuring consistent heat levels to protect hair from damage while drying. It also offers 8 styling modes with adjustable wind speeds and temperature settings, making it highly customizable for various hair types. In comparison, the Wavytalk Hair Dryer features three temperature settings and two airflow speeds, including a cool air option. While both models provide temperature control, the Tideway offers more versatility in styling options, which can be appealing to users with specific hair care needs.
